学习吧(EduBoo.COM) 本次搜索耗时 8.517 秒,为您找到 84 个相关结果.
  • 第7章 应用

    2586 2020-01-06 《把时间当作朋友》
    第七章:应用 第七章:应用 兴趣 经常有学生向我表示他对目前的专业没兴趣—他真正 感兴趣的是某某专业。看得出来,这些人常常不快乐,因为 他们(觉得)自己正在做自己不喜欢做的事情。然而,事实果真这样吗?不客气地说,在 99% 的情况下, 并非如此。首先,这些人其实并不是对自己正在做的事情没有兴趣, 而是没有能力把目前正在做的事情做好。几乎没有人会喜欢 ...
  • 4.4 使用同步操作简化代码

    4.4 使用同步操作简化代码4.4.1 使用期望值的函数化编程 4.4.2 使用消息传递的同步操作 4.4.3 并发技术扩展规范中的持续性并发 4.4.4 持续性连接 4.4.5 等待多个期望值 4.4.6 使用when_any等待第一个期望值 4.4.7 并发技术扩展规范中的锁存器和栅栏机制 4.4.8 std::experimental::latch:基...
  • 6.2 分而治之

    分而治之方法介绍 问题实例 举一反三 分而治之 方法介绍 对于海量数据而言,由于无法一次性装进内存处理,导致我们不得不把海量的数据通过hash映射分割成相应的小块数据,然后再针对各个小块数据通过hash_map进行统计或其它操作。 那什么是hash映射呢?简单来说,就是为了便于计算机在有限的内存中处理big数据,我们通过一种映射散列的方式让数据均匀...
  • 5.3 格子取数

    格子取数问题题目描述 分析与解法 举一反三 格子取数问题 题目描述 有n*n个格子,每个格子里有正数或者0,从最左上角往最右下角走,只能向下和向右,一共走两次(即从左上角走到右下角走两趟),把所有经过的格子的数加起来,求最大值SUM,且两次如果经过同一个格子,则最后总和SUM中该格子的计数只加一次。 分析与解法 初看到此题,因为要让两次走下来...
  • 第三章-编程进阶-数据结构与算法

    第三章-编程进阶-数据结构与算法算法+数据结构=程序 不会Coding如何破?Notes 第三章-编程进阶-数据结构与算法 首先让我们看看Wikipedia上对数据结构和算法的定义。 数据结构(Data Structure)是计算机中存储、组织数据的方式。通常情况下,精心选择的数据结构可以带来最优效率的算法。 算法(Algorithm)是指完成...
  • 2.9 完美洗牌

    完美洗牌算法题目详情 分析与解法解法一、蛮力变换1.1、步步前移 1.2、中间交换 解法二、完美洗牌算法2.1、位置置换pefect_shuffle1算法 2.2、完美洗牌算法perfect_shuffle22.2.1、走圈算法cycle_leader 2.2.2、神级结论:若2*n=(3^k - 1),则可确定圈的个数及各自头部的起始位置 2.2.3、完...
  • 排错

    1330 2020-01-05 《gulp 入门指南》
    排错View 不更新的问题 React Router 0.13 的 route 变化中,view 不更新 Redux 外部的一些东西更新时,view 不更新 在 context 或 props 中都找不到 “store” Invariant Violation:addComponentAsRefTo(…):只有 ReactOwner 才有 refs。这通常意...
  • 3.3 最近公共祖先LCA

    最近公共祖先LCA问题问题描述 分析与解法解法一:暴力对待1.1、是二叉查找树 1.2、不是二叉查找树 解法二:Tarjan算法2.1、什么是Tarjan算法 2.2、Tarjan算法如何而来 2.3、Tarjan算法流程 解法三:转换为RMQ问题 3.1、什么是RMQ问题3.2、如何解决RMQ问题3.2.1、Trivial algorithms for...
  • 2.3 寻找和为定值的多个数

    寻找和为定值的多个数题目描述 分析与解法解法一 解法二 0-1背包问题 举一反三 寻找和为定值的多个数 题目描述 输入两个整数n和sum,从数列1,2,3…….n 中随意取几个数,使其和等于sum,要求将其中所有的可能组合列出来。 分析与解法 解法一 注意到取n,和不取n个区别即可,考虑是否取第n个数的策略,可以转化为一个只和前n-1个数相关...
  • 1.5 最长回文子串

    最长回文子串题目描述 分析与解法解法一 解法二、O(N)解法 最长回文子串 题目描述 给定一个字符串,求它的最长回文子串的长度。 分析与解法 最容易想到的办法是枚举所有的子串,分别判断其是否为回文。这个思路初看起来是正确的,但却做了很多无用功,如果一个长的子串包含另一个短一些的子串,那么对子串的回文判断其实是不需要的。 解法一 那么如何高效...